Unsaturated rhamnogalacturonyl hydrolase 105A, Bacteroides thetaiotaomicron
Unsaturated rhamnogalacturonyl hydrolase 105A (BtUrh105A), assigned the E.C. number 3.2.1.172, is a derivative of Bacteroides thetaiotaomicron. It catalyzes the hydrolysis of unsaturated rhamnogalacturonan disaccharide to yield unsaturated D-galacturonic acid and L-rhamnose. The recombinant BtUrh105A, purified from Escherichia coli, is a single-domain Glycoside Hydrolase family 105 (GH105) enzyme (see more details at www.cazy.org).
